Que.
What happened when Ketoconazole is given with Diazepam?
A.
Increase blood level of Diazepam
B.
Decrease blood level of Diazepam
C.
Inhibit metablsm of Diazepam
D.
Both and c
Right Answer is :
✓ D. Both and c
